Isotopes: Principles and Applications, 3rd Edition |
| Gunter Faure (Ohio State University); Teresa M. Mensing (Ohio State University) |
| Covering radiogenic, radioactive, and stable isotopes, this comprehensive text contains five sections that present fundamentals of atomic physics; dating methods for terrestrial and extraterrestrial rocks by means of radiogenic isotopes; geochemistry of radiogenic isotopes; dating by means of U, Th-series and cosmogenic radionuclides; and the fractionation of the stable isotopes of H, C, N, O, and S, as well as Li, B, Si, and Cl. Additionally, this edition provides: *Expanded coverage of the U-Pb methods –the most accurate available dating technique *Applications to the petrogenesis of igneous rocks *Summaries of the use of isotopic data for study of the oceans *New examples from the fields of archeology and anthropology *Radiation-damage methods of dating including fission tracks, thermoluminescence, and electron spin resonance (ESR) *Information on the dispersal of fission-product radionuclides and the disposal of radioactive waste *Extensive chapter-by-chapter problems and solutions
